The National. This Alt-Rock group has been surging up the charts for years now and this album is the reason behind it. Powerful with such grace, this album will take you on an adventure. You get deep into singer/songwriter Matt Berninger’s emotional state as this album encompasses many seasons of his life. From “Terrible Love’s” hollow melody to the bone-chilling imagery of “Runaway,” something in this album is going to resonate deeply with you, whatever stage of life you’re in. If you take the time to listen through this masterpiece in order, you’ll find it all leads up to the maestrocity of “England,” a gripping track that punches you right in the core, bringing the whole album together. If you’re interested in alternative rock or just a music junkie in general, you’ll find this collection well worth your time, and at the very least you’ll learn what the chart-topping band The National owes their popularity to. |
